At Voltalia we are passionate about renewable energies! We are an electricity producer from wind, solar, hydro, biomass and storage and also a service provider to 3rd party clients such as Development, EPC, O&M and Distribution.Today we are in 20 countries, split among 4 continents, and offering a global operating capacity to our clients. We are listed on the regulated Euronext market in Paris since July 2014.

 

Based in the Stonehouse office, the HR Manager for the UK will have the following responsibilities:

  • Prepare and propose Strategic Lines that will govern the activities of the area, in the Country, and the respective Plan of Activities, in order to ensure the achievement of the defined objectives;
  • Foster the values of Voltalia throughout the organization, engaging the employees in the right context of work, communication and development;
  • Follow-up employee’s engagement, deploying strategies and initiatives that aim to improve employee’s motivation, happiness and well-being;
  • Identify, with the support of the direct team, internal and transversal improvement to be carried out;
  • Coordinate the Human Resources area and the Human Resources team, defining responsibilities, evaluating performance, activities to be carried out and respective owners, and training and motivation actions, in order to guarantee the development and good performance of employees under direct responsibility and, consequently, the achievement of defined objectives;
  • Work, in collaboration with the Human Resources top management, to define/apply Voltalia HR Policies, in compliance with the current legal framework, ensuring the implementation and management of all processes and instruments that these policies trigger;

  • Manage HR activities, namely, Recruitment, Selection and Integration of new employees; Training and Development; Remuneration Policy: fixed and variable remuneration, Benefits; Administrative Management of Human Resources; Evaluation of Performance, Internal Communication;
  • Coordinate the work related to the activity indicators of the Human Resources area, to guarantee their availability to the Management, in accordance with the defined reporting mechanisms and deadlines, and ensuring the expected levels of reliability of the information produced;
  • Ensure the interconnection between the human resources and the other areas in Voltalia, in order to guarantee the fluidity of communication in the various levels of hierarchy and responsibility, and the resolution of cross-cutting problems, aiming to foster synergies and to improve the operational performance and efficiency of the organization;
  • Participate actively in the "committees" and local/group Projects that may exist, per request from the direct Management;
  • Implement the training and development plans defined for the Country, following-up its effectiveness;
  • Ensure an interface with external legal counsel, requesting various opinions and following up all labor litigation actions, as well as the legal component of ongoing projects in the area of human resources management;
  • Others that may be assigned.
